Output 868c6124b1d25f9831fa91609c3e113cc3d8aa5e56df84bc1db4317f9217303e:0

value
148000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f5c8ef951a245260ac0e8ad4c8bc1d621421e8423632d27b732aaab9c937703a
address
bc1p7hywl9g6y3fxptqw3t2v30qavg2zr6zzxcedy7mn924tnjfhwqaqvl4dxl
transaction
868c6124b1d25f9831fa91609c3e113cc3d8aa5e56df84bc1db4317f9217303e
spent
true